# High-load performance validation
Feature: Bulk Order Processing
  Scenario: Validate 5k items throughput
    Given a JSON payload with 5000 items
    When I POST to "/api/v2/orders/bulk"
    And I wait for process ID "772"
    Then response time is < 450ms
    And DB reflects "COMPLETED" status
Scenario Outline: Auth Roles Validation
  Given the user is on ""
  When I login with "" credentials
  Then access should be ""

  Examples:
    | page | role | allow |
    | Admin | ROOT | TRUE |
    | Store | USER | FALSE|
Feature: UI Gestures Suite
  Scenario: Swipe to Delete Item
    Given mobile app is on "Inbox" view
    When I perform a "Left Swipe"
    And click on the "Trash" icon
    Then element should not be visible
# SQL validation for data integrity
When SQL query "SELECT * FROM inventory"
  Then row count is > 0
About Me
victorferreira.dev
Quality is
intelligent,
not a checklist.

Test Automation Specialist focused on Java, working across API, Mobile, and Web automation — integrating tests into CI/CD pipelines and cloud environments.

I go beyond traditional QA. I build AI-driven solutions that generate test scenarios from Azure DevOps stories and automate code review from GitHub & GitLab repositories.

Experience with performance testing, database validation, and active contribution to technical interviews and team onboarding.

7+ Years of
Experience
5+ Companies
Served
3 Platforms
API · Web · Mobile
CSTE International
Certification
Download CV PDF · 2026

QA

Victor Scroll Down
Scroll Down
My Skill Board
VF
Victor Ferreira / QA Automation Analyst
Sprint 2025.01
📍 São Paulo, SP Online
BASIC 3
SKL-013 LOW
HTML & CSS
Basic knowledge of HTML and CSS for building and customizing web interfaces.
frontend html css ui
SKL-014 LOW
Gatling (Performance Testing)
Basic performance testing using Gatling for load and stress test scenarios.
performance load-testing gatling
SKL-015 LOW
ADB (Android Debug)
Usage of ADB for interacting with Android devices and debugging automation flows.
android adb debug mobile
INTERMEDIATE 5
SKL-008 MEDIUM
Python (Automation & Scripting)
Development of automation scripts and data processing using Python for testing and integrations.
python scripting automation backend
SKL-009 MEDIUM
CI/CD Automation (Jenkins, GitLab)
Integration of automated tests into CI/CD pipelines using Jenkins and GitLab CI.
ci cd jenkins gitlab devops
SKL-010 MEDIUM
BrowserStack (Cloud Testing)
Execution of automated tests on cloud device farms for cross-platform validation.
cloud browserstack mobile testing
SKL-011 MEDIUM
API Testing Concepts
Understanding of API testing concepts including validation, contract testing, and data handling.
api testing validation contracts
SKL-012 MEDIUM
AI / Computer Vision (YOLO)
Use of computer vision models (YOLO) for object detection and intelligent automation workflows.
ai yolo computer-vision automation
ADVANCED 7
SKL-001 HIGH
Web Automation with Java (Selenium)
Automated end-to-end web testing using Selenium WebDriver with Java, applying Page Object Model and scalable test architecture.
java selenium web automation
SKL-002 HIGH
Mobile Automation (Appium)
Mobile test automation for Android and iOS using Appium, including device farms and cross-platform validation.
appium java mobile android ios
SKL-003 HIGH
API Test Automation (Rest-Assured)
Automated API testing using Rest-Assured, including validation, chaining requests, and response assertions.
api rest java automation
SKL-004 HIGH
BDD with Cucumber
Behavior-driven development using Cucumber and Gherkin for readable and maintainable test scenarios.
bdd cucumber gherkin automation
SKL-005 CRITICAL
Test Automation Framework Design
Design and implementation of scalable automation frameworks using best practices like POM and layered architecture.
architecture framework qa design
SKL-006 CRITICAL
Test Strategy & QA Practices
Definition of QA strategy, test planning, and quality processes across multiple squads and environments.
qa strategy process quality
SKL-007 HIGH
Git & Version Control (GitFlow, PR Review)
Source control management using Git, including branching strategies, pull requests, and code review practices.
git version-control collaboration
CURRENT 1
EXP-001 CRITICAL
Automation Analyst — Unicred
Responsible for manual and automated testing of the Unicred app (consortium area). Developed Python automation scripts and CI/CD pipelines with Jenkins. Used Azure DevOps for task management and versioning. Worked with Web APIs and mobile feature validation.
📅 03/2024 - Present 🏢 DBC Company
python jenkins azure mobile api ci/cd
PREVIOUS 4
EXP-002 HIGH
Automation Analyst — Sicredi (Digiagro)
Responsible for automating the Digiagro app (iOS and Android), integrating with BrowserStack device farm and GitLab CI pipeline. Worked in an agile squad focused on agile testing for digital banking portals. Used Jira for task management and automated execution report generation.
📅 03/2022 - 03/2024 🏢 NTT DATA
appium java browserstack gitlab ios android jira
EXP-003 HIGH
Automation Analyst — Alelo (Meu Alelo)
Responsible for automating the Meu Alelo and MeuEc apps (iOS and Android) and the full Web API layer. Developed mobile automation framework with Appium, Java, Cucumber and PageObjects (BDT). Built REST API framework with report generation and metrics. Integrated Jenkins CI/CD pipelines and used Azure DevOps for task management.
📅 01/2020 - 03/2022 🏢 Taking
appium java cucumber api rest jenkins azure bdd
EXP-004 MEDIUM
Automation Analyst — PagBank
Responsible for automated test development for the PagBank app, covering backend and mobile frontend. Developed performance tests with Gatling. Managed activities in Jira (stories, bugs, tasks). Created BDD test scenarios and automated test pipelines with Jenkins.
📅 01/2019 - 12/2019 🏢 Taking / PagSeguro
gatling jenkins mobile bdd jira performance
EXP-005 LOW
Automation Analyst Jr — Cielo
Worked in an agile squad responsible for the full mobile app automation. Developed mobile automation framework with Appium, Java, Cucumber and PageObjects (BDT). Built REST API automation framework with report generation and prepared DeviceFarm and Jenkins CI/CD integration.
📅 01/2018 - 01/2019 🏢 RSI Informatica
appium java cucumber api jenkins bdd mobile
ACADEMIC 2
EDU-001
B.Sc. in Information Systems
FIAP — College of Informatics and Business Administration.
📅 2018 - 2023
degree IT
EDU-002
High School
Fundação Bradesco.
📅 2015 - 2017
high-school
CERTIFICATIONS 1
CERT-001 HIGH
CSTE — Certified Software Tester
Quality Assurance Institute.
📅 2023 - 2025
certification QA
Scroll Down